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 9, Causey Drive, Stanley is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£231,645 and a rental value of £1,135 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£205,171 and a rental value of £1,006 per month.

Energy Efficiency
9, Causey Drive, Stanley has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 27 Apr 2023.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 9, Causey Drive, Stanley was last sold on 18th August 2023 for £166,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
Since August 2023, the market for similar properties has dropped by 0.6%.
